On Wednesday, ESPN analyst and former NFL safety Ryan Clark said that Smith wasn't apologetic about owing money, and he had put his finger in Enemkpali's face and said, "you're not going to do anything about it":

"It became about the fact that Geno wasn't necessarily apologetic, and being, in a way, remorseful about the money, when saying he was going to pay IK back. You know, he didn't, and he was rather smug about it. So these guys got into it earlier in camp about this money. My report says Geno put his finger in [Enemkpali's] face and told the guy, 'Well, you're not going to do anything about it.'"

Clark also said it wasn't the first time a situation arose between the two players, but the first incident ended with both players walking away. Clark reiterated on Twitter that while Smith didn't deserve to be punched, it also shouldn't be considered a "sucker punch":

Manish Mehta of the New York Daily News also spoke to players on the Jets who said Smith "deserved" to be punched:

Smith "was up in (Enemkpali’s) face and pointed/touched his face," according to a source.

"Geno deserved it," another source said.

...

It’s unclear how matters escalated, but Smith’s finger-pointing in his teammate’s face was grounds for a punch, according to some.

"That’ll get a man hit every time, especially one that hasn’t earned respect," a source said.

In the immediate aftermath of the fight, cornerback Darrelle Revis said he holds both players responsible, which was the original suggestion that perhaps Smith wasn't blameless in the incident.

As Clark said, Smith didn't deserve to be punched — and certainly not forced out for half of the season in what many consider a make-or-break year — but it sounds like he didn't act responsibly. Very few Jets players have come to his defense since the incident.
